I have a 93 Dakota 3.9 V6 and I determined that the dist. Drive gear bushing was bad, I replaced the gear and bushing without too much trouble but then I noticed that the plug wires were not in the correct position on the dist. So I decided to fix that too.

I have tried to index the distributor drive following the procedure but the problem is that no matter what I do in order to get the reluctor in the right spot to trigger the fuel the rotor is pointed about half way between #1 terminal and #6. I can get the truck to run by wiring the plugs with #1 in #6 spot and so on, just one place out of sync.

The engine idles very poorly, surges, occasionally pops on starting and so on.

Questions.

1.Is there a way to determine where the dist. Drive gear should be set? The old one had a pin mark on it but the new one has none. Even if there was one there is nothing to line it up with.
2.The leading edge of the reluctor is right in line with the rotor so how are you supposed to set the fuel sync. And have the rotor point at the #1 mark on the plastic plate and also the #1 terminal in the cap? These two points are about 20 degrees off each other.

3.The reluctor plate in my old dist. Was about to fall completely off of the plastic base it mounts to so I took it off, cleaned it up and hot glued it back in place. I was pretty careful to make sure I lined it back up right, 4 rivets and one guide pin, however the new dist has the reluctor about 20 degrees out from the old one. The dist. Cap is the same (if I had a cap that was set with the terminals rotated a bit things would line up)Are there more than one distributor for this motor? I can get it to run a little better with the old dist. but the terminals still don't line up properly.
